Windshield Protection Film: Long-Term Durability & Safety for All Vehicles

What It Does

Windshield Protection Film (WPF) is a transparent, impact-resistant film applied to your windshield to protect it from chips, cracks, and scratches. Over time, windshield damage can weaken structural integrity, and WPF provides a durable solution to prevent costly replacements.

Colored PPF: Maintaining a Custom Look for Years

What It Does

Colored Paint Protection Film (PPF) is a durable, customizable film that protects your car’s paint while allowing you to change its color. Unlike traditional vinyl wraps, colored PPF offers superior durability, self-healing technology, and UV resistance for long-term protection.

Slate PPF: Long-Term Protection for Headlights and Taillights

What It Does

Slate PPF is a smoked or tinted paint protection film designed for headlights, taillights, and fog lights. Unlike vinyl overlays, Slate PPF offers both protection and a stylish smoked effect while maintaining brightness and compliance with visibility laws.
